[email protected] changed: What |Removed |Added ---------------------------------------------------------------------------- CC| |[email protected] --- Comment #2 from [email protected] --- I replicated this bug on AOO 4.2 rev 1846059 on a Windows 10 Enterprise desktop for files types TXT, RTF, and PNG. I could not replicate the bug on prior version AOO 4.1.6 rev 1844436 on a Windows 10 Enterprise desktop for file types TXT, RTF, and PNG. I also tried file types OXPS and WMV, and I noticed a different behavior in AAO 4.2, where the generic icon and title show up after (instead of before) double-clicking on the object. These file types appear as icons in the document instead of showing their content in the document. Initially, an appropriate icon and title is shown in the document, but after you double-click on the icon and open the file, it changes to the plug-in icon with a generic Object title. Steps to replicate: 1) Open a new Writer document 2) From the menu, select Insert>Object>OLE Object 3) From the “Insert OLE Object” dialog, select “Create from File”, then use the Search button to select a file with a WMV extension. Make sure “Link to file” is not checked and select OK. 4) Note that an appropriate icon and title appears on the object. 5) Double-click on the object, then select Open from the “Open Package Contents” dialog. The WMV file opens in a video player app. Close this app. 6) Note that the object icon has changed to a plug-in icon and the title has changed to Object 1. Actual Result: Icon and title on object are changed to a generic icon and title Expected Result: Appropriate icon and title on object are retained Additional information: This behavior does not occur when using the “Link to file” option for a WMV file.
